Grampian man injured in rear-end crash

SHARE NOW

Jay Township, PA – A Grampian man was seriously injured when he rear-ended another vehicle in Elk County.

43-year-old Joshua Palmer had been driving his Hyundai Elantra along Bennetts Valley Highway in Jay Township around 8:30 a.m. on Feb. 15.

A Toyota Tacoma driven by 74-year-old Edward Benevich from Weedville had stopped on the road to make a left turn, and Palmer ended up striking the vehicle from behind.

Benevich had been wearing a seat belt and was not injured.

Palmer was not wearing a seat belt and was taken to Penn Highlands DuBois with serious injuries. He’s being charged with following too closely.
